Loopia, a Brazilian startup specializing in AI agents for e-commerce, has secured R$ 6.5 million in a Seed funding round. Led by Parceiro Ventures, the investment will fuel the company's mission to automate and enhance digital commerce operations. This new capital is earmarked for product development, channel expansion, and scaling its market presence.


Strategic Investment and Growth Trajectory

The funding was spearheaded by new partner Parceiro Ventures, with a clause that could increase the total to R$ 8.5 million based on growth milestones. The round also saw continued support from existing investors Quartzo, Funses I, ACE Founders, and ABVC Latam. These firms previously backed Loopia in its R$ 3.7 million Pre-Seed round in 2025.

This investment follows a period of remarkable expansion, as the company reported a 25-fold growth in 2025. Now in its second year, Loopia is focused on scaling its commercial team and targeting enterprise clients. The company aims to multiply its operations by at least five times over the next 18 months.

Revolutionizing E-commerce Operations

Loopia's platform addresses a critical pain point for online sellers by centralizing customer interactions from disparate channels. It integrates with major marketplaces like Mercado Livre, social platforms like TikTok Shop, and proprietary e-commerce sites. This unified ecosystem allows businesses to manage their digital presence from a single, intelligent dashboard.

The core of its service is AI agents that operate 24/7 and respond to customer queries in under 30 seconds. These agents manage the entire consumer journey, from pre-sale questions and cart recovery to post-sale support. This automation improves efficiency and allows human teams to focus on more complex strategic tasks.

A Natively AI-Powered Architecture

According to its lead investor, Loopia's key advantage lies in its foundational architecture. The platform was developed natively with generative AI, rather than being a traditional system with an AI layer added on. This design allows agents to understand context, prioritize tasks, and proactively execute complex operational workflows.

Diane Zehil, Vice President of Parceiro Ventures, highlighted this distinction as a crucial factor in their investment. She noted that with Loopia, automation transcends simple auto-replies to become a truly intelligent operational tool. Zehil confirmed that clients have validated the effectiveness of this generative AI-native approach in practice.

Experienced Leadership and Future Outlook

The company was founded in 2024 by CEO Tiago Vailati and CTO Anderson Fantini, both seasoned technology entrepreneurs. Vailati previously founded Hiper, a retail software startup acquired by Linx for R$ 50 million in 2019. Fantini brings over 15 years of experience, having led more than 100 software projects across various sectors.

With the new funds, Loopia plans to enhance its product and broaden its ecosystem of integrated sales channels. The founders aim to address outdated manual processes in retail, where delayed responses often result in lost sales. The company is also a member of the WhatsApp AI Startups Hub, a program by Meta supporting innovative AI applications.
